Development of an Ethernet-Based Heuristic Time-Sensitive Networking Scheduling Algorithm for Real-Time in-Vehicle Data Transmission
The rapid development and adaptation of advanced driver assistance systems (ADAS) and autonomous driving increases the burden of in-vehicle networks. In-vehicle networks are now required to provide a fast data rate and bounded delay for real-time operation, while conventional protocols such as contr...
Main Authors: | , , , |
---|---|
Format: | Article |
Language: | English |
Published: |
MDPI AG
2021-01-01
|
Series: | Electronics |
Subjects: | |
Online Access: | https://www.mdpi.com/2079-9292/10/2/157 |
id |
doaj-e343255e08d4417cb5a5689c811cd22f |
---|---|
record_format |
Article |
spelling |
doaj-e343255e08d4417cb5a5689c811cd22f2021-01-14T00:02:21ZengMDPI AGElectronics2079-92922021-01-011015715710.3390/electronics10020157Development of an Ethernet-Based Heuristic Time-Sensitive Networking Scheduling Algorithm for Real-Time in-Vehicle Data TransmissionHyeong-jun Kim0Min-hee Choi1Mah-ho Kim2Suk Lee3School of Mechanical Engineering, Pusan National University, Busan 46241, KoreaSchool of Mechanical Engineering, Pusan National University, Busan 46241, KoreaDivision of Automotive Engineering, Dong-eui Institute of Technology, Busan 47230, KoreaSchool of Mechanical Engineering, Pusan National University, Busan 46241, KoreaThe rapid development and adaptation of advanced driver assistance systems (ADAS) and autonomous driving increases the burden of in-vehicle networks. In-vehicle networks are now required to provide a fast data rate and bounded delay for real-time operation, while conventional protocols such as controller area networks, local interconnected networks, and FlexRay begin to show limitations. Ethernet-based time-sensitive network (TSN) technology has been proposed as an alternative. TSN is a set of Ethernet standards being developed by the IEEE TSN task group, which aims to satisfy requirements such as real-time operation, stability, and low and bounded latency, and it can be used in automotive, industrial, and aerospace applications. This study introduces several standards for Ethernet traffic scheduling based on TSN technology and proposes a heuristic-based scheduling algorithm for Ethernet scheduling. In addition, three network configurations are simulated using OMNeT++ to show the applicability. The heuristic TSN scheduling algorithm is a straightforward and systematic procedure for practical network designers.https://www.mdpi.com/2079-9292/10/2/157automotive Ethernettime-sensitive networking (TSN)audio video bridge (AVB)in-vehicle networkEthernet scheduling |
collection |
DOAJ |
language |
English |
format |
Article |
sources |
DOAJ |
author |
Hyeong-jun Kim Min-hee Choi Mah-ho Kim Suk Lee |
spellingShingle |
Hyeong-jun Kim Min-hee Choi Mah-ho Kim Suk Lee Development of an Ethernet-Based Heuristic Time-Sensitive Networking Scheduling Algorithm for Real-Time in-Vehicle Data Transmission Electronics automotive Ethernet time-sensitive networking (TSN) audio video bridge (AVB) in-vehicle network Ethernet scheduling |
author_facet |
Hyeong-jun Kim Min-hee Choi Mah-ho Kim Suk Lee |
author_sort |
Hyeong-jun Kim |
title |
Development of an Ethernet-Based Heuristic Time-Sensitive Networking Scheduling Algorithm for Real-Time in-Vehicle Data Transmission |
title_short |
Development of an Ethernet-Based Heuristic Time-Sensitive Networking Scheduling Algorithm for Real-Time in-Vehicle Data Transmission |
title_full |
Development of an Ethernet-Based Heuristic Time-Sensitive Networking Scheduling Algorithm for Real-Time in-Vehicle Data Transmission |
title_fullStr |
Development of an Ethernet-Based Heuristic Time-Sensitive Networking Scheduling Algorithm for Real-Time in-Vehicle Data Transmission |
title_full_unstemmed |
Development of an Ethernet-Based Heuristic Time-Sensitive Networking Scheduling Algorithm for Real-Time in-Vehicle Data Transmission |
title_sort |
development of an ethernet-based heuristic time-sensitive networking scheduling algorithm for real-time in-vehicle data transmission |
publisher |
MDPI AG |
series |
Electronics |
issn |
2079-9292 |
publishDate |
2021-01-01 |
description |
The rapid development and adaptation of advanced driver assistance systems (ADAS) and autonomous driving increases the burden of in-vehicle networks. In-vehicle networks are now required to provide a fast data rate and bounded delay for real-time operation, while conventional protocols such as controller area networks, local interconnected networks, and FlexRay begin to show limitations. Ethernet-based time-sensitive network (TSN) technology has been proposed as an alternative. TSN is a set of Ethernet standards being developed by the IEEE TSN task group, which aims to satisfy requirements such as real-time operation, stability, and low and bounded latency, and it can be used in automotive, industrial, and aerospace applications. This study introduces several standards for Ethernet traffic scheduling based on TSN technology and proposes a heuristic-based scheduling algorithm for Ethernet scheduling. In addition, three network configurations are simulated using OMNeT++ to show the applicability. The heuristic TSN scheduling algorithm is a straightforward and systematic procedure for practical network designers. |
topic |
automotive Ethernet time-sensitive networking (TSN) audio video bridge (AVB) in-vehicle network Ethernet scheduling |
url |
https://www.mdpi.com/2079-9292/10/2/157 |
work_keys_str_mv |
AT hyeongjunkim developmentofanethernetbasedheuristictimesensitivenetworkingschedulingalgorithmforrealtimeinvehicledatatransmission AT minheechoi developmentofanethernetbasedheuristictimesensitivenetworkingschedulingalgorithmforrealtimeinvehicledatatransmission AT mahhokim developmentofanethernetbasedheuristictimesensitivenetworkingschedulingalgorithmforrealtimeinvehicledatatransmission AT suklee developmentofanethernetbasedheuristictimesensitivenetworkingschedulingalgorithmforrealtimeinvehicledatatransmission |
_version_ |
1724338746483015680 |